UNBROKEN -The Movie, opening Christmas Day: Angelina Jolie directed this true story of LOUIE ZAMPERINI. He ran in the 1936 Olympics, met Hitler at the Fuhrers request. When World War II breaks out, Louie enlists in the military. After his plane crashes in the Pacific, he survives an incredible 47 days adrift in a raft. There he promised God he would dedicate his life to him if he got out alive. Then he was rescued/captured by the Japanese navy. Sent to a POW camp, Louie becomes the favorite target of a particularly cruel prison commander. When the war ended, he backslid, until until his wife dragged him to a Billy Graham revival. Then he went to Japan to forgive his cruel captors. Very famous. I was told his story at my YMCA summer camp when i was in 6th grade. UNBROKEN is the best-seller by Laura Hillenbrand (who wrote Sea Biscuit). This movie has been advertised for almost a year, much anticipated. Louis died this year at 97.
